Police arrests slot machine player
The player is accused of robbery
The authorities of Sparks, in the state of Nevada, have reported that the local police have recently arrested a person that is suspected of being the author of a series of robberies and, also, of initiating fires in public places. The suspect is 46 years old, his name is Bernardo Cruz Mosquera and he was caught in a track stop in Sparks, minutes after he had robbed a McDonalds restaurant.

The police said that the criminal took the manager of the restaurant as a hostage and ran away, threatening to hurt the man if he was followed. After that, he forced the manager to give him the money, which went up to $4,800.

Police Sergeant, Randy Saulnier, said that they are investigating the possibility of this person having participated in other robberies that are still to be solved.
